Transaction 70d16608df6afb7052f2ef292a3a6dd65ccc67254e3758dec70a4f8ef85ab7a2

block
2578d1f1d9384a19a022399d97b361070ce23d50d5f8e559fb54b5d22f31e093

2 Inputs

2 Outputs